Arthur Dresen
About Arthur Dresen
Arthur Dresen serves as the Operations Director EMEA at Beyond Meat, bringing extensive experience in supply chain and operations management across various industries. He has held significant roles at companies such as British American Tobacco, pladis Global, and Tyson Foods, focusing on implementing LEAN methodologies to enhance operational efficiency.

Previous Experience at 247TailorSteel
Before joining Beyond Meat, Arthur Dresen worked at 247TailorSteel as the COO and International Operations Director (a.i.) for a period of five months in 2023. His role involved managing operations on-site in Varsseveld, Gelderland, Netherlands, where he focused on enhancing operational performance.
Education and Expertise
Arthur Dresen studied at Delft University of Technology, where he earned a Master of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ering from 1989 to 1995. He has a strong background in implementing LEAN methodologies, particularly Integrated Work Systems (IWS), aimed at driving sustainable performance improvements in various organizations.
Career at British American Tobacco
Arthur Dresen has held multiple roles at British American Tobacco from 2001 to 2017. His positions included Head of Operations & Supply Chain for Other Tobacco Products in Western Europe, Head of Service - Global Supply Chain, and Strategic Account Manager for Supply Chain in Western Europe.
